Airtel and 3MTT Launch NextGen Fellowship to Equip Young Nigerians with Real Tech Skills

Airtel Africa Foundation, in partnership with the 3 Million Technical Talent (3MTT) programme, has unveiled the Airtel x 3MTT NextGen Fellowship, a targeted initiative designed to equip young Nigerians with the skills and experience needed to thrive in the digital economy.

This special fellowship is part of the broader 3MTT programme, led by the Federal Ministry of Communications, Innovation & Digital Economy and implemented by NITDA, aiming to cultivate a future-ready tech workforce across Nigeria.

What the Fellowship Offers

The Airtel x 3MTT NextGen Fellowship selects exceptional young Nigerians and trains them in key tech areas, including:

  • Software development
  • Data science
  • UI/UX design
  • Cloud computing
  • Product management
  • Cybersecurity
  • Artificial Intelligence (AI) and machine learning

Learners will not only receive high-quality, free training, but also mentorship from experienced tech professionals, hands-on project experience, and access to a nationwide tech community. Projects are designed to bridge classroom learning with real-world applications, enabling participants to build portfolios that demonstrate their capabilities to potential employers.

Benefits for Participants

  • Free training in core digital skills
  • Mentorship and guidance from industry experts
  • Hands-on project work that translates to real-world portfolios
  • Access to national tech networks and communities
  • Clear pathways to internships, jobs, and entrepreneurial ventures

Who Can Apply

The fellowship is open to young Nigerians with a passion for tech and a commitment to completing the full programme. Ideal applicants include:

  • Students and recent graduates eager to start a tech career
  • Job seekers looking to gain in-demand digital skills
  • Creators and innovators with tech ideas
  • Professionals transitioning from other fields into tech

Applicants should be prepared to engage in projects, hackathons, and collaborative work throughout the fellowship.
